I am a Professor in the Computer Science Department at the School of Computer Science at Carnegie Mellon University.
I am also Co-Founder and CEO of Conviva Inc.During 2000 - 2003, I was the Chief Technical Officer of Turin Networks (merged with Force 10 Networks in 2009 and acquired by Dell in 2011).

Research Interests
My research interests are in Internet video, future Internet architecture, and network control archirecture and protocols.
